Step 1
Preheat the oven to 160°C/320°F. Line a large baking tray with parchment paper.
Step 2
In a large mixing bowl, combine the roughly chopped almonds, walnuts, and pecans, along with the sunflower seeds, pumpkin seeds, and cashews.
Step 3
In a small bowl, mix together the cinnamon, ginger, cardamom, and allspice until well combined. Add the spice mixture to the nut mixture and toss to evenly coat.
Step 4
In a separate small bowl, whisk together the rice malt syrup and vanilla extract until smooth. Pour the mixture over the nut mixture and stir until all the nuts and seeds are coated.
Step 5
Transfer the mixture to the prepared baking tray and spread it out in an even layer. Bake for 20-25 minutes, stirring once halfway through, until golden brown and fragrant.
Step 6
Remove from the oven and let cool completely on the tray. Once cool, break the granola into clusters.
